Output 7c66980a83afba3fb545a8df58f9776d3a57d40b810365241933fc0f3c7e0507:21

value
6240919
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99bf735cc43df136575f8f9c3775edd0288543fb OP_EQUALVERIFY OP_CHECKSIG
address
1F1wjaFfmT8aExutt6rRz64S7c4k5u8YyH
transaction
7c66980a83afba3fb545a8df58f9776d3a57d40b810365241933fc0f3c7e0507
spent
true